Honda XL 700 V Transalp - 2008 Specifications and Reviews

The 2008 Honda XL 700 V Transalp is a mid-sized adventure bike designed for riders seeking versatile on-road and off-road capability. Powered by a 680cc V-twin engine delivering 59 horsepower, it excels at middleweight touring and moderate trail riding. Known for its reliable liquid-cooled performance and balanced handling, it appeals to adventurous commuters and weekend explorers.

Rider Profile

Best ForSuits riders from intermediate level upward who want a forgiving, upright adventure-touring bike rather than a high-performance machine.
PurposeBuilt primarily for long-distance touring and mixed on/off-road travel rather than outright speed or hardcore off-roading.
Rider FitA tall 19-inch front wheel and moderate 218 kg dry weight mean it favors riders of average to taller height who are comfortable managing a substantial, top-heavy machine at low speed.
CharacterA relaxed, torque-friendly V-twin adventure bike that rewards smooth, steady riding over aggressive throttle use.
Not Ideal ForNot ideal for riders seeking sharp sport-bike acceleration, track-day performance, or serious technical off-road capability.
